Resumen

The Digital Elevation Model of the Jalisco Triple Junction area obtained from a SPOT panchromatic stereopair makes it possible to infer the tectonic development of this area: 1) an old NS trending fault network developed throughout the studied area. The faults which bound the southern Colima Graben are considered as a heritage of this system. 2) The E-W Citala Graben cuts the preceding fault network. 3) The N 135 trending Zacoalco Graben is associated with a detachment fault dipping to the NE and the N 40 trending northern part of the Colima Graben, bounded by the Techaluta Fault, are part of an active fault network associated with the recent development of the Jalisco Triple Junction.
